With the international break over and Premier League football returning to St James’ Park this weekend, we’re entering a busy and potentially season-defining spell for Newcastle United.
Between now and the next break, we play SEVEN times in just 23 days, averaging almost a game every three days.
Here’s the fixture list over the next three weeks, where we have four winnable Premier League games, two Champions League ties with AC Milan and PSG, along with a Carabao Cup clash with Man City:
Saturday 16th September – Newcastle v Brentford (5.30pm) Sky Sports – Premier League
Tuesday 19th September – AC Milan v Newcastle (5.45pm) TNT Sports – Champions League
Sunday 24 September – Sheff Utd v Newcastle (4.30pm) Sky Sports – Premier League
Wednesday 27 September – Newcastle v Man City (8pm) Sky Sports – Carabao Cup
Saturday 30 September – Newcastle v Burnley (3pm) – Premier League
Wednesday 4th October – Newcastle v PSG (8pm) – TNT Sports – Champions League
Sunday 8 October – West Ham v Newcastle (2pm) – Premier League
It starts with a huge week, as our trip to the San Siro next Tuesday sandwiched is between winnable league games against Brentford and newly-promoted Sheffield United.
Hopefully we can build some confidence and kickstart our league campaign with a big win at St James’ Park this weekend, sending us to Milan in better spirits in what promises to be a memorable night for the club after 20 years away from Champions League football.
